Key Facts
- AsiaSat 4's instance of is recorded as communications satellite[3].
- AsiaSat 4's instance of is recorded as geostationary satellite[4].
- AsiaSat 4's COSPAR ID is recorded as 2003-014A[5].
- AsiaSat 4's space launch vehicle is recorded as Atlas IIIB[6].
- AsiaSat 4's SCN is recorded as 27718[7].
- AsiaSat 4's UTC date of spacecraft launch is recorded as +2003-04-12T00:00:00Z[8].
- AsiaSat 4's significant event is recorded as rocket launch[9].
- AsiaSat 4's start point is recorded as Cape Canaveral Launch Complex 36[10].
